While Elden Ring: Shadow of the Erdtree has received critical acclaim, its Steam reception is more divisive. Players are voicing concerns about difficulty and performance issues across PC and consoles.
Steam Screenshot Despite pre-release accolades and a high Metacritic score, Elden Ring: Shadow of the Erdtree launched to a wave of negative player reviews on Steam. While the challenging gameplay is praised, many find the combat excessively difficult and unbalanced. Performance problems are also widespread.
Reddit Screenshot The intensity of battles is a major point of contention. Players report encounters significantly harder than the base game, citing poorly designed enemy placement and excessively high boss health pools.
Performance issues plague both PC and PlayStation players. PC users report crashes, stuttering, and low frame rates, even on high-end systems. Consoles also experience significant frame rate drops during intense gameplay.
Metacritic Screenshot As of Monday, Steam shows a "Mixed" rating for Elden Ring: Shadow of the Erdtree, with 36% negative reviews. Metacritic's user score is "Generally Favorable" (8.3/10) based on 570 ratings, while Game8 gives it a 94/100 rating.
